An Austro-Hungarian Anti-Aircraft Detachment Badge Auction Blackened ironAn Imperial (1914 1917) Austro Hungarian Luftfahrzeug Abwehr Kanonen Abteilung badge; in copper wash bronzed zink; vertical pinback; unmarked; measuring 26 mm (w) x 40 mm (h); with 50% of its original finish worn off; in overall near very fine condition.
